  • A piston core (587 cm long) was recovered from the upper slope of a seamount in the Korea Plateau. Three episodes of sedimentation were identified based on sedimentary facies, grain size distribution, carbonate constituents and initial $^{87}Sr/^{86}Sr$ ratio of carbonates. The lower part of the core, Unit I-a (core depth $465{\sim}587cm$) is composed of shallow marine carbonate sediments the deposited by storm surges, and is about $13{\sim}15Ma$ (Middle Miocene) based on $^{87}Sr/^{86}Sr$ initial ratio. This suggests that the depositional environment was relatively shallow enough to be influenced by storm activities. Unit I-b (core depth $431{\sim}465cm$) is mostly composed of turbidites, and Sr isotope ages of bivalves and planktonic formaminifera are about $11{\sim}14\;and\;6{\sim}13Ma$, respectively. This indicates that the Korea Plateau maintained shallow water condition until 11 Ma, and began to subside since then. However, planktonic foraminifera were deposited after 11 Ma and redeposited as turbidites as a mixture of planktonic foraminifera and older shallow marine carbonates about 6 Ma ago. Unit II (core depth $0{\sim}431cm$) is composed of pelagic sediments, and the Sr isotope age is younger than 1 Ma, thus the time gap is about 5 Ma at the unconformity. About 1 Ma ago, the Korea Plateau subsided down to a water depth of about 600 m. The sampling locality was intermittently influenced by debris flows and/or turbidity currents along the slope, resulting the deposition of re-transported coarse shallow marine and volcaniclastic sediments.

  • This study was designed to be a link in the chain of the investigation on daily life and consciousness of longevous people in Korea, and to investigate the regional feature of longevity areas. The daily life and consciousness were investigated on 379 subjects(male 121, female 258) of the aged who were above 80 years of age, from June to November in 1985. This paper is to report the results investigated the longevity rate, distribution, classification and weather of longevity districts, and also the actual conditions such as the functions of daily life and educational degree of longevous people. 1. The number of longevous people in Korea was 171,449 (male 42,842, female 128,607), and the average longevity rate was 0.46% against total population in Korea(male 0.23%, female 0.69%). 2. Of the longevity rates of shi and/or do in Korea, Cheju(1.03%) was the highest among these districts, and decreased in the order of Chonnam(0.79%), Chonbuk(0.66%), Kyongbuk(0.65%) and Kyongnam(0.61%), whereas the large cities such as Inchon(0.22%), Seoul(0.23%), Pusan(0.23%) and Taegu(0.28%) were remarkably lower than districts in seasides and mountains. 3. The districts above 1.0% of longevity rate in Korea showed 17-guns, and the distribution of these districts was 10-guns of Chonnam, 2-guns of Kyongbuk and Kyongnam, and 1-gun of Kyonggi, Cho-nbuk and Cheju, respectively. 4. Of these districts, Pukcheju(1.65%) was the highest, and decreased in the order of Namhae(1.56%), Sungju(1.24%), Posong(1.22%) and Koksong(1.20%). The highest figure(male 0.71%, female 2.51%) was observed in Pukcheju as contrasted with 0.23%(male) and 0.69%(female) of the average longevity rate in Korea. 5. The sex ratio of longevous people in Korea showed the female/male ratio of 3.0. It is, therefore, believed that the longevity rate of female was 3 times higher than that of male. 6. The longevity districts were classified into seven districts in seasides, three districts in isolated islands, and seven rural districts in mountains. 7. The situation of weather in longevity districts was in the range of 11.2 to $14.8^{\circ}C$ at annual average temperature, and 878.5 to 1585.9mm at annual average rainfall. 8. Of the educational degree of longevous people, uneducated(71.5%) was the highest, and followed by the order of village school(15.8%) and above elementary school(4.8%). 9. In the functions of daily life, the aged moving actively(53.0%) was the highest among these longevous people, followed by the aged moving a little(23.5%). Therefore, it is believed that health degree of these longevous peoples by the functions of daily life was very gratifying.

  • Compositional variation of sphalerites from various hydrothermal metallic ore deposits in Korea were investigated in mine and local, and regional scale. The sphalerites were partially analyzed for iron, manganese, and cadmium by using an electron probe microanalyzer(EPMA). The contents of iron and cadmium in sphalerites collected from the Weolam deposit of the No.1 Yeonhwa mine are not variable with increase of depth, but manganese content is highly variable. Sphalerites from lead-zinc deposits which are geologically associated with hypabyssal and effusive activity are characterized by high manganese (more than 1.0 MnS mole %) and low cadmium contents (less than 0.5 CdS mole %). Relatively manganese rich sphalerites are found in the deposits where sphalerites are enriched in iron content. Variation of cadmium content is very limited compared with that of manganese content. Sphalerites from most tungsten and some gold-silver deposits are remarkably high in cadmium content, but most of base metal and iron deposits are low in cadmium content. Cadmium content in sphalerites which occur in the metallic ore deposits genetically associated with plutonic activity shows a tendency to high variation. Available amounts of cadmium in sphalerites could be originated from the initial enrichment during the magmatic and postmagmatic processes.

  • Catalytic activities of the partial oxidation of methane (POM) to hydrogen were investigated over Pd(5)/Ti-SPK and Pd(5)/Zr-SPK in a fixed bed flow reactor (FBFR) under atmosphere, and the catalysts were characterized by BET, XPS, XRD. The BET surface areas, pore volume and pore width of Horvath-Kawaze, micro pore area and volume of t-plot of Pd(5)/Ti-SPK and Pd(5)/Zr-SPK were $284m^2/g$, $0.233cm^3/g$, 3.9 nm, $30m^2/g$, $0.015cm^3/g$ and $396m^2/g$, $0.324cm^3/g$, 3.7nm, $119m^2/g$, $0.055cm^3/g$, repectively. The nitrogen adsorption isotherms were type IV with hysteresis. XPS showed that Si 2p and O 1s core electronlevels of Ti-SPK and Zr-SPK substituted Ti and Zr shifted to slightly lower binding energies than SPK. The oxidation states of Pd on the surface of catalysts were $Pd^0$ and $Pd^{+2}$. XRD patterns showed that crystal structures of fresh catalyst changed amorphous into crystal phase after reaction. The conversion and selectivity of POM to hydrogen over Pd(5)/Ti-SPK and Pd(5)/Zr-SPK were 77, 84% and 78, 72%, respectively, at 973 K, $CH_4/O_2$ = 2, GHSV = $8.4{\times}10^4mL/g_{cat}{\cdot}h$ and were kept constant even after 3 days in stream. These results confirm superior activity, thermal stability, and physicochemical properties of catalyst in POM to hydrogen.

  • This study tested the association between genetic polymorphisms of the isocitrate dehydrogenase 3, beta subunit (IDH3B) gene and economic traits in an F2 crossbred population of Landrace × Jeju (South Korea) Black pigs. A 304-bp insertion/deletion mutation in promoter region was screened for determining genotypes of the IDH3B gene in a total of 1,105 F2 pigs. Three genotypes (AA, AB, and BB) were identified in the founder, F1, and F2 populations. Association analysis showed significant differences in carcass weights (CW), backfat thicknesses in three positions of the body (4th-5th ribs, BF5; 11th-12th ribs, BF12; 13th rib-1st lumbar, BFL), and carcass lengths (CL) (p<0.05), but not in meat color (MC), eye muscle area (EMA), or marbling scores (MARB) (p>0.05). The F2 IDH3B BB homozygotes showed heavier CW (80.790±0.725 kg) and shorter CL (101.875±0.336 cm) than the other genotypes (p<0.05). In addition, the BF levels between the 4th - 5th and 11th - 12th vertebrae were thicker in the carcasses of pigs with the IDH3B BB genotype than with the other genotypes (p<0.05). These results suggested that genetic variations in the IDH3B gene may serve as molecular genetic markers for improving the Landrace × Jeju Black pig crossbreeding systems.

  • This study investigated the role of excitatory amino acid systems in the initiation of organophosphate-induced seizures and brain damages in rats through quantitative in vivo microdialysis. Microdialysates were collected from the hippocampus of rat brain, treated with diisopropylfluorophosphate (DFP; 2.67 mg/kg, s.c.) alone, and/or atropine sulfate (15 mg/kg, i.m.) and procyclidine (30 mg/kg, i.m.). The protective effects of atropine, a muscarinic blocker, and/or procyclidine, a N-methyl-D-aspartate and cholinergic antagonist, against DFP were examined. DFP treatment increased the levels of aspartate (Asp) and glutamate (Glu) significantly in the hippocampal persuate with the induction of seizures. Treatment of procyclidine could effectively block the increase of Asp and Glu levels. Atropine treatment showed no significant anticonvulsive effects against DFP-induced seizures. The increases of Asp and Glu levels by DFP were also completely blocked through the combined treatment of atropine and procyclidine. Histopathological findings on the hippocampus confirmed the above results. More effective protection was observed through the treatments of procyclidine alone or of both procyclidine and atropine than atropine alone against DFP-induced brain damage. Procyclidine was shown to be effective in DFP-induced seizures.
